Title: To authorize the Human Resources Director to enter into a contract with EyeMed Vision Care, LLC and its wholly owned subsidiary, First American Administrators, Inc. to provide all eligible employees vision plan administration from February 1, 2023 through January 31, 2024; to authorize the expenditure of $1,221,000.00 from the Employee Benefits Fund, or so much thereof as may be necessary, to pay the costs of said contract; and to declare an emergency. ($1,221,000.00)
Attachments: 1. 3288-2022 Vision attachment
Explanation

BACKGROUND: Additional funding of the vision insurance program is necessary to insure continuation of the vision insurance program in accordance with the negotiated labor contracts. The Human Resources Department requests to contract with EyeMed Vision Care, LLC and its wholly owned subsidiary, First American Administrators, Inc. and to provide funding from February 1, 2023 through January 31, 2024 for this program. The program services approximately 24,000 active benefit enrolled employees, their dependents and COBRA participants.

The contract term is 3 years, with two (2) one (1) year renewals. This represents year two of the three year contract.
The total obligation of this contract is $1,221,000.00. The breakdown of expense is $21,000.00 for administrative fees and $1,200,000.00 for claims.
Cost estimates for 2023 are based on 2021-2022 benefit fund expenditures using a two year average of actual city utilization, expected changes due to union negotiations, as well as input from insurance carriers and from the City's employee benefits consultant.
Emergency action is requested to ensure the vision insurance program for city employees is able to commence as soon as contractually possible, thereby maintaining continuity of service.

FISCAL IMPACT: Funding is available in the 2023 Employee Benefits Fund for this contract. This ordinance is contingent on the passage of the 2023 insurance appropriation ordinance 3284-2022.
